Design and progress of a wideband 120–210 GHz low noise amplifier

Abstract: In order to further improve the sensitivity and resolution of radiometer front-ends and also astronomy applications, amplifiers are needed with the lowest noise figure and high flat gain in G-band frequency range. Hence, we designed and demonstrated a MMIC LNA using Agilent EEHEMT model of 0.07 μm InP HEMT for operating at 120 210 GHz frequency broadband range.
